What is the ruling of Islamic law concerning a woman who requested khul‘ (divorce initiated by the wife) after her husband discovered her relationship with a male colleague at work?

1 min readAlso available in العربية

A woman's relationship with a non-mahram man is a sin, and if she is married, the sin is greater due to her defiance of her husband and her rebellion. It is impermissible for her to seek khul' (divorce initiated by the wife) without a valid legal reason. The husband has the right to refuse to divorce her until she ransoms herself from him. If separation occurs, she has no right to custody of her children until she repents from her immorality. This story is evidence of the danger of mixing between sexes at work, and that what a woman earns due to such sinful relationships is unlawful. Since the khul' has taken place, seek a righteous wife and supplicate frequently.
